Mail Notice definition

Mail Notice means the notice that is mailed by the Settlement Administrator to potential Settlement Class Members, in a form substantially similar to Exhibit A to this Agreement and/or as ultimately approved by the Court.
Mail Notice means the Notice of Proposed Settlements of Class Action to be provided to the Classes as provided in this Settlement Agreement, the Preliminary Approval Order, and the Notice Order.
Mail Notice means the postcard notice that will be provided pursuant to Section III.E.1 of this Agreement, subject to approval by the Court, substantially in the form attached hereto as Exhibit 2.
